Abstract: An electronic device is provided. The electronic device includes a substrate and a plurality of light-emitting assemblies. The substrate includes a first edge, an edge region, and a central region. The edge region is adjacent to the first edge. The central region is adjacent to the edge region and away from the first edge. The light-emitting assemblies are disposed on the substrate, and each of the light-emitting assemblies has a tuning element and a light-emitting element. The light-emitting assemblies further include a first light-emitting assembly and a second light-emitting assembly. The first light-emitting assembly is disposed in the central region and has a first light-emitting pattern. The second light-emitting assembly is disposed in the edge region and has a second light-emitting pattern. At a viewing angle of 60°, the brightness of the first light-emitting pattern is higher than the brightness of the second light-emitting pattern.

Abstract: A backlight module includes a light guide plate having an upper surface, a lower surface, and light-adjusting structures on the lower surface; an optical sheet disposed opposite to the upper surface of the light guide plate; and a light source disposed adjacent to the light guide plate, wherein a light emitted by the light source has a first brightness distribution in a first direction after passing through the light guide plate, and the first brightness distribution has a first maximum brightness corresponding to a first angle and a second maximum brightness corresponding to a second angle, and an absolute value of the first angle and an absolute value of the second angle are greater than 60 degrees, respectively, wherein an absolute value of a difference between the first maximum brightness and the second maximum brightness is less than or equal to 30% of the first maximum brightness.

Abstract: A display device and a method for manufacturing the same are disclosed. The display device includes a backlight module, a display panel, and a decorative film. The backlight module includes: a reflective layer disposed on the decorative film; a light guide plate disposed on the reflective layer, a set of optical films including a first diffusion layer, and at least one refractive layer. The light guide plate has a first surface facing the reflective layer and a second surface opposite to the first surface, and the first diffusion layer is disposed on the second surface. At least one refractive layer is disposed on at least one of the first surface and the second surface, wherein a refractive index of the refractive layer is between 1.15 and 1.45. The display panel is disposed on one side of the set of optical films far away from the light guide plate.

Abstract: A display device is disclosed, which includes: a display panel; and a backlight module corresponding to the display panel. The backlight module includes: a light source; and a light guide plate adjacent to the light source and having a surface and a light guide dot. The light guide dot comprises a first valley and a second valley, the first valley has a first valley point, and the second valley has a second valley point. On the basis of the surface of the light guide plate as a reference surface, the first valley is recessed into the reference surface, the second valley is recessed into the reference surface, a distance from the first valley point to the reference surface is defined as a first depth, a distance from the second valley point to the reference surface is defined as a second depth, and the first depth is different from the second depth.
